IONIA, Magnesia ad Meandrum. Circa 150-142 BC. AR tetradrachm (16,74 g). Euphemos, son of Pausanias, magistrate. Head of Artemis to right, wearing stephane; bow and quiver over shoulder / MAΓNHTΩN - EYΦHMOΣ ΠAYΣANIOY, Apollo standing to left, resting on tripod to right, holding laurel branches in right hand; meander pattern below. All within laurel wreath. Areas of weak strike. Well preserved surfaces. Light toning. Purchased from Poinsignon Numismatique Grade:0/01
